Output bf4c23d1982a3fbe24dfbe77683680a26b4354d583d7aa7b5d044eaecc637c4d:1

value
3010000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29a962fc1c3a8af7169274abe40ea36cc719f296 OP_EQUAL
address
35VJYbmQWYwG1aWwnm3SsXULQiWSfSfpZe
transaction
bf4c23d1982a3fbe24dfbe77683680a26b4354d583d7aa7b5d044eaecc637c4d
confirmations
334851
spent
true